Abstract
The use of the anisotropic reactive reflector is to eliminate cross-polarization is considered for the following two cases: a parabolic antenna fed by a dipole; and a parabolic antenna fed by a source radiating symmetrical E/sub 01/ or H/sub 01/ circular waveguide modes. The reflector surface impedance properties and design features typical for feed examples are discussed.<>
